Gilisoft RAMDisk is a Windows utility that creates a virtual drive inside system memory for short-lived data. It is designed for cache, temporary folders, scratch files, and repeat-read workloads where speed matters more than permanent retention.

It behaves like a normal drive that applications can use directly.
Appears in Windows Explorer as a standard drive.
Supports custom size and drive letter selection.
Allows file system choices during setup.
Lets apps read and write as usual.
It is built for temporary in-memory storage, not for long-term or recovery-focused tasks.
Not intended to replace normal hard drives or SSDs.
Not designed for bare-metal recovery workflows.
Best only when the system has comfortable spare RAM.
Temporary data may be lost after restart when not preserved.

| Operating Systems | Windows 11: Home / Pro / Education / Enterprise Windows 10: Home / Pro / Education / Enterprise Windows 8: Core / Pro / Enterprise Windows 7: Starter / Home Basic / Home Premium / Professional / Ultimate / Enterprise Windows Vista: Starter / Home Basic / Home Premium / Business / Enterprise / Ultimate Windows XP: Home / Professional Windows Server 2003: Standard / Enterprise / Datacenter / Web |
| Memory RAM | RAM disk size depends on available system RAM |
| Hard Disk | 6.1 MB free space |
| Display | Standard display compatible with the respective operating system |
| Special Features | Creates a virtual disk stored in system RAM. RAM disk is accessible in Windows Explorer and other Windows applications. RAM disk can be shared over a network. Supports custom RAM disk size, drive letter, and file system configuration. Supports RAM disk image creation and mounting. Supports auto-create empty RAM disk after restart. Supports auto-load of the most recent image after restart. Supports automatic image saving on restart, shutdown, sleep, or hibernation. Supports backup image before saving. Supports scheduled image saving every 1 to 60 minutes. Supports real-time saving of changes to the image file. |
| Note | Windows-only software. No separate .NET Framework, browser, or driver dependency required. |
